Assistant Director for TRIO Student Support Services Doane UniversityAssistant Director for TRIO Student Support ServicesCrete, NEThe Assistant Director for TRIO Student Support Services works directly with the Executive Director of Academic Support Services in all facets of the TRIO SSS program to oversee the first-year experience for incoming TRIO SSS students, summer outreach to students and families, participation in Enrollment Days, and assisting with the coordination of Welcome Week and TRIO-specific sessions. In this highly collaborative role, you will work with the Academic Engagement Coordinator to manage and develop TRIO events throughout the year, work closely with the Executive Director of Academic Support Services to supervise the TRIO Tiger Peer Mentorship program (recruiting, training, and coaching mentors), and teach one section each of College Mastery and Career.
